The Journey

Celyne-dyon's weight loss journey was one she took on alone, but with the support of online communities. She started by making small changes to her diet, cutting out unhealthy snacks and sugary drinks. She also incorporated more fruits and vegetables into her meals. As her body adapted to the changes, she added exercise to her routine, starting with short walks and gradually working her way up to regular gym sessions.

The Results

Celyne-dyon's hard work paid off, and she was able to shed an impressive 32lbs in just over a year. The most striking change was in her face, with photos showing a significant decrease in puffiness and a more chiseled chin. She attributes her success to consistency and patience, recognizing that weight loss isn't an overnight process but a journey that requires time and commitment.

Lessons Learned

From her weight loss journey, celyne-dyon learned the importance of setting realistic goals and tracking progress. She found that tracking her meals and exercise helped her stay accountable and motivated. She also learned to be kind to herself, recognizing that weight loss plateaus and setbacks are a normal part of the process.
